Abstract

Uno de los cuadros clínicos más significativos por su incidencia sobre el dolor pelviano y la fertilidad lo constituye la endometrosis. Es una patología que genera dismenorrea progresiva y limitante para la calidad de vida de la mujer, y que constituye hoy una entidad prevalente que genera preocupación como problema de la salud pública. Su incidencia creciente en mujeres en edad fértil genera la postergación de su fertilidad ,a expensas,básicamente,de la priorización del dolor como síntoma cardinal y la dificultad y demora que suele presentar para su diagnóstico adecuado y la aplicación de terapéuticas no siempre acordes a la dimensión que representa.
